Cancer is a group of diseases characterized by the uncontrolled growth and spread of abnormal cells in the body. Normally, cells grow, divide, and die in a regulated manner. However, in cancer, genetic mutations disrupt this process, causing cells to grow uncontrollably and evade the body’s natural defenses. These abnormal cells can form tumors, invade nearby tissues, and spread (metastasize) to other parts of the body through the bloodstream or lymphatic system.

Cancer can originate in nearly any part of the body, with different types classified based on their tissue of origin. Some cancers, like leukemia, do not form solid tumors but instead affect the blood and bone marrow. Cancer risk is determined by a combination of genetic, environmental, and lifestyle factors, and while some risk is inherited (i.e., specific gene mutations that increase risk of certain cancer types), most cancer incidence occurs due to an accumulation of mutations acquired over a lifetime. Early detection and preventive measures can significantly improve survival rates and treatment outcomes.

This article explains the links between cancer risk and 30 different micronutrients (including some with complex relationships to cancer risk, so not straightforwardly just decreasing risk across the board)—including specific vitamins, minerals, amino acids, and fatty acids. This long list of nutrients is not meant to imply that you should track or optimize each one individually. Rather, it illustrates the value of nutrient-dense, diverse eating patterns, which naturally provide these nutrients by emphasizing a wide variety of mostly whole foods. I also want to be clear that while a nutrient-dense diet is associated with a lower risk of developing many types of cancer, nutrition cannot eliminate cancer risk, nor should these nutrients be viewed as treatments for cancer.

In addition, cancer risk is influenced by many factors beyond food alone, including genetics, age, environmental exposures, infections, hormone status, body weight, physical activity, smoking, alcohol consumption, sun exposure, and chance. A nutrient-dense diet can meaningfully reduce the risk of many cancers and support overall health, but it is not a guarantee, a cure, or a moral safeguard.

Predominant Cancer Types in the United States

Cancer remains one of the leading causes of death in the United States. According to the American Cancer Society (ACS) and Centers for Disease Control and Prevention (CDC), the most common types of cancer in the U.S. include breast cancer, lung cancer, prostate cancer, colorectal cancer, and skin cancer. These cancers have varying risk factors and strategies for prevention and early detection.
